Why is the Mobile Sterile Units Market Growing?

  • Hospital sterilization capacity constraints are creating demand for mobile and deployable sterilization systems across healthcare networks.
  • Emergency preparedness mandates and military healthcare investment are supporting procurement of field-deployable sterile units.
  • China leads growth at 7%, reflecting healthcare infrastructure expansion and surgical volume growth.

The mobile sterile units market is growing as hospitals and healthcare networks invest in sterilization capacity that can be deployed rapidly during facility renovations, disaster response, and surgical backlogs. Mobile sterile units provide on-site steam, gas, or ultraviolet sterilization capability without permanent infrastructure investment. Hospitals account for the largest end-user share, reflecting the need for supplemental sterilization during operating room expansions and infection control surges.

Government procurement programs for emergency preparedness and military healthcare are supporting demand for trailer-mounted and truck-mounted units that can be transported to field locations. Emerging markets in Asia and the Middle East are investing in mobile sterilization as a cost-effective alternative to building permanent central sterile supply departments. The portable segment is gaining traction for use in specialty clinics and outpatient surgical centers where space constraints limit fixed sterilization equipment.

Hospital Sterilization Capacity Gaps

Demand reflects surgical volume growth and facility renovation cycles that create temporary sterilization capacity shortfalls. Mobile sterile units allow hospitals to maintain surgical throughput during CSSD (Central Sterile Supply Department) renovations, equipment failures, or infection control surges. This application provides recurring rental and procurement opportunities.

Emergency Preparedness and Disaster Response

Government procurement programs for emergency preparedness are creating demand for deployable sterilization systems. Military healthcare and disaster relief operations require mobile sterile units that can operate in field conditions. Trailer-mounted units with self-contained utilities represent the primary format for this application.

Emerging Market Healthcare Infrastructure

Healthcare systems in Asia, the Middle East, and Africa are investing in sterilization capability. Mobile sterile units offer a cost-effective alternative to building permanent CSSD facilities, particularly in rural and underserved areas. This application is growing as healthcare coverage expands in emerging markets.

Equipment Cost and Maintenance Requirements

High initial capital costs and ongoing maintenance requirements limit adoption in budget-constrained healthcare settings. Rental and leasing models are emerging to address this barrier. Manufacturers that offer comprehensive service contracts alongside equipment sales are gaining procurement share.
